Sepahan: Tactical Approach and Current Form
Sepahan enters this match in strong form, having won four of their last five games. Their recent success has been built on a disciplined, high-intensity pressing game and a direct attacking style. Under their coach, Sepahan has adopted a 4-3-3 formation, with an emphasis on quick transitions from defense to attack. Their pressing from the front is designed to disrupt the opposition's buildup play, forcing errors in the middle third, and allowing them to exploit those mistakes with rapid counter-attacks.
In the final third, Sepahan's wingers are key to their attacking strategy. They look to stretch the opposition defense, pulling defenders wide to create space in the center for their striker. The combination of pace and dribbling from the wings ensures that Sepahan are always a threat in one-on-one situations, and they often look for early crosses into the box to catch the opposition off-guard.
Key metrics to note for Sepahan: they average 58% possession per game, with an impressive 82% passing accuracy. Their xG (expected goals) stands at 1.9 per match, showing that they are creating high-quality chances. However, their defensive line has shown vulnerabilities in recent matches, particularly when defending set pieces. Despite their dominance in open play, they concede an average of 1.1 goals per match, which will be an area to watch against Gol Gohar's potent attacking force.
In terms of personnel, Sepahan’s central midfield is the engine of their system. With the tireless efforts of their box-to-box midfielder, they control the tempo of the game. The attack will rely heavily on their star winger, who has been in sensational form, registering 3 goals and 2 assists in the last five games. However, their starting central defender is suspended for this clash, which could undermine their defensive stability. This suspension may lead to a more conservative approach in their defensive setup.
Gol Gohar: Tactical Approach and Current Form
Gol Gohar, meanwhile, arrives in a more mixed run of form, with two wins, two draws, and one loss in their last five fixtures. Their tactical setup, under a more pragmatic coach, is focused on a solid defensive foundation paired with a quick, direct style of attack. Their 4-4-2 formation allows them to remain compact in the middle, forcing the opposition wide where they can double up on wingers and minimize crossing opportunities. Gol Gohar’s primary strategy is to hit teams on the counter, using the pace of their forwards and midfielders to exploit the space left behind by high-pressing sides.
Statistically, Gol Gohar’s defensive solidity stands out. They have a lower average possession of around 48%, but they’re efficient in possession, with an 80% passing accuracy. Their xG per match is 1.5, slightly lower than Sepahan’s, indicating that they tend to create fewer but more decisive opportunities. Gol Gohar is also difficult to break down, conceding only 0.8 goals per match. Their midfielders, although not as dynamic as Sepahan’s, provide a solid shield for the defense and contribute to the counter-attacks with accurate long balls.
Gol Gohar’s standout player is their central striker, who has been involved in 4 of their last 5 goals. He’s a physical presence in the box, often capitalizing on crosses and long balls. Their full-backs also play a crucial role, providing width in attack but also ensuring they are always positioned to track back and support their center-backs. A potential blow for Gol Gohar is the absence of their starting left-back due to injury, which could cause imbalance in their defensive unit.
Head-to-Head: History and Psychology
The last few encounters between Sepahan and Gol Gohar have been tightly contested. In their previous three meetings, Sepahan has managed two wins, while Gol Gohar took a single victory. However, those results tell only part of the story. In all three matches, both teams showed tactical discipline, with low-scoring affairs, reflecting their respective defensive solidity. What stands out is the psychological battle between the two; Sepahan’s attacking prowess clashes with Gol Gohar’s disciplined, counter-attacking style. These recent encounters have always been decided by moments of individual brilliance or tactical mistakes, rather than clear-cut team dominance.
Key Battles and Critical Zones
The most crucial individual battle will likely unfold between Sepahan’s right-winger and Gol Gohar’s right-back. Sepahan’s winger has been in scintillating form, with 4 goals and 3 assists in his last five matches, and will be looking to exploit Gol Gohar’s vulnerable left-side defense. The absence of Gol Gohar’s starting left-back could expose them even more in this area, and Sepahan will be keen to take full advantage.
Another key battle will occur in the center of the park. Sepahan’s high-pressing game will clash with Gol Gohar’s counter-attacking style. Sepahan’s midfielders will need to disrupt Gol Gohar’s buildup and limit the space for their creative midfielders to launch counter-attacks. If Gol Gohar’s midfield can weather the early storm and break through the lines, they could exploit Sepahan’s higher defensive line with quick balls into their striker.
The final critical zone will be in the wide areas. Both teams utilize their full-backs to either create width or support defensive duties. The interplay between the full-backs and wingers will be pivotal in determining which team can maintain offensive fluidity while keeping a tight defensive shape.
